Instructions
Preheat over to 375 degrees.
Either spray your muffin pan or add baking cups.
In a mixing bowl, combine milk, eggs, syrup, and coconut oil and mix until combined.
Add in baking powder, baking soda, salt, baking powder, cinnamon and vanilla.
Add in oats and mix well.
Add in flour and mix well.
Gently fold in blueberries.
Scoop batter into pan, filling each muffin cup 3/4's of the way full.
Bake for about 15 minutes.
Cool on wire rack.
Notes
If you aren't eating these muffins right away, freeze them so they don't go bad. If you wrap them individually, they will be a quick, easy breakfast.
